What Are the Best Music Video Distribution Platforms?

In the digital age, artists have more opportunities than ever to distribute their music videos and tracks to a global audience. Choosing the right music video distribution platform can make a significant difference in how your content is received and how broad your reach is. This article will guide you through some of the best music video distribution platforms and offer step-by-step instructions on how to upload your audio on Spotify.

Best Music Video Distribution Platforms

Various platforms provide exceptional services for distributing your music videos. Here are some of the top-rated options:

1. YouTube

Known as the go-to platform for video content, YouTube offers unparalleled reach. It has a vast audience and robust tools for artists to monetize their content. With features like YouTube Shorts and Community posts, it's easier than ever to engage your audience.

2. Vevo

Vevo is a platform specifically designed for music videos. Partnered with major labels, it offers high-quality music video distribution and promotional tools. If you are looking for a more professional setting, Vevo is an excellent option.

3. TikTok

There's no denying TikTok's broad impact on the music industry. With its short-form video format, it's a superb platform for music promotion and discovery. TikTok integrates seamlessly with SoundOn, giving artists a unique edge in distributing their music.

4. Instagram

Instagram's IGTV and Reels are increasingly popular for music video content. With a strong focus on visual content, Instagram allows you to engage with your audience through posts, stories, and more.

5. Facebook

While not solely a video platform, Facebook offers robust tools for video distribution and audience engagement. Facebook Watch and regular posts provide a comprehensive suite for promoting music videos.

6. Vimeo

If you're looking for high-quality video hosting with advanced customization options, Vimeo is a great choice. It's preferred by independent artists for its professional features and ad-free environment.

How to Upload Audio on Spotify

Spotify is one of the leading digital streaming platforms, making it a must for any artist looking to reach a broad audience. Here’s a detailed guide on how to upload your audio on Spotify:

Step 1: Choose a Music Distribution Service

Spotify does not allow direct uploads from artists, so you’ll need to use a music distribution service like SoundOn, TuneCore, or CD Baby. These services will distribute your music to Spotify and other digital streaming platforms.

Step 2: Create an Account

Sign up for an account on your chosen distribution service. You will need to provide essential details such as name, email, and payment information.

Step 3: Prepare Your Audio and Metadata

Ensure your audio file is high-quality and in the correct format (preferably WAV or MP3). Gather all necessary metadata (song title, artist name, album title, release date, genre, etc.) and album artwork meeting Spotify’s guidelines.

Step 4: Upload Your Track

Log into your distributor's dashboard, follow the prompts to upload your audio file, and enter all metadata. Double-check everything to avoid errors.

Step 5: Review and Submit

After uploading, review all details carefully. Submit your track for distribution. The service will then handle the rest, sending your audio to Spotify for review and publication.

Step 6: Claim Your Spotify for Artists Profile

Once your music is live, claim your Spotify for Artists profile. This allows you to access detailed analytics, promote playlists, and customize your artist profile.

Step 7: Promote Your Music

Promotion is key. Share your Spotify link on social media, embed it on your website, and engage with your audience to build a following. Utilize Spotify's playlist pitching tools to increase your chances of getting featured on curated playlists.
